On my 500A when the aux and engine hydraulic pumps are running the Hyd pressure never settles at 500/1000 respectively. The gauge is constantly wobbling between 450-500 on the electric and 950-1000 when the engines are running. Also when we did the gear swing the right gear began to drop after a few minutes and the flaps slowly go to full deflection. This is again ONLY on the right MLG side but both sides on the flap droops. Any Ideas would be greatly appreciated.

It's so long ago and I'm going from memory, but I think you have an accumulator that's bad or leaking (or just needs to nitro up). Seem to recall you get low, unstable pressures when that's the problem.

Adam is correct but it could also indicatea leak somewhere. There are lots of places that may be leaking and it only takes one to cause that.  if you can’t find a leak check the accumulator pressure. It is in your left main gear well and has presure port at the bottom. fill with nitrogen.
